## 内容主体大纲1. **引言** - 什么是比特币? - 为什么需要冷钱包?2. **冷钱包的定义与类型** - 冷钱包与热钱包的区别...
比特币作为一种广受欢迎的数字货币,它的核心在于其底层技术——区块链,而用户与比特币网络的交互则依赖于比特币钱包的使用。比特币钱包的安全性与私钥的管理直接相关,那么一个比特币钱包究竟有几个私钥呢?本文将会对此进行深入探讨,并且通过分析比特币钱包的构成和功能,帮助读者理解这些问题。
比特币钱包实际上是一种管理比特币地址及其私钥的软件或硬件,它能够帮助用户接收、存储以及发送比特币。比特币钱包的主要功能有以下几个方面:
1. **生成和管理比特币地址**:比特币地址是用户接收比特币的“账号”。每个钱包都可以生成多个比特币地址,以便用户能够方便地管理不同的交易。
2. **安全存储私钥**:每个比特币地址背后都有一个私钥,用户必须安全地存储私钥,因为它是进行交易的唯一凭证。
3. **执行交易**:比特币钱包允许用户通过提供相应的私钥来进行比特币的发送和接收操作。
4. **查看交易历史**:用户可以通过钱包查看其交易记录,以便于管理自己的资产。
首先,我们需要理解什么是私钥。简单来说,私钥是一串复杂的字符串,用于签署交易并证明你对比特币资金的所有权。每个比特币地址都对应一个私钥,但一个比特币钱包通常可以生成多个比特币地址,因此一个比特币钱包可以包含多个私钥。
具体来说,大部分现代比特币钱包(例如,HD钱包或分层确定性钱包)都允许用户生成多个地址和私钥。这是因为HD钱包采用了一种算法(BIP32),可以依赖于一个主私钥(master private key)生成无限数量的子私钥(子地址)。这种设计使得用户更容易管理资产,因为他们不需要为每个新地址手动生成新的私钥。
钱包中私钥的安全性至关重要,因为一旦私钥被盗,黑客就可以完全控制该地址下的资产。因此,了解比特币钱包的安全性是非常重要的,主要有以下几种方式:
1. **冷钱包与热钱包**:冷钱包不与互联网连接,因此相对安全。热钱包则与互联网连接,易于使用但风险更高。用户应根据自己的需求选择合适类型的钱包。
2. **备份和恢复**:用户应定期备份钱包并保管妥当的恢复种子(通常是12或24个单词),万一设备损坏或丢失,可以通过恢复种子找回私钥和资产。
3. **加密和多重签名**:对私钥进行加密或使用多重签名功能,可以有效减少被盗的风险。多重签名钱包需要多个私钥同时签署才能完成一笔交易。
除了对私钥的安全管理,用户在使用比特币钱包时,还应注意以下几个方面:
1. **选用可信的服务商**:选择知名度高、评价好的数字货币钱包服务商,以免遇到诈骗。
2. **确保软件更新**:钱包软件应保持更新,以防止已知的安全漏洞影响钱包安全。
3. **避免钓鱼网站**:谨慎点击链接,确保访问官方网站,防止掉入钓鱼网站的陷阱。
私钥是比特币钱包的核心,用户需要理解一旦丢失私钥,将会失去对其所管理的比特币的完全控制权。比特币是去中心化的资产,恢复比特币钱包的关键在于私钥或种子短语。若无备份,就无法恢复。
可以通过以下案例来更好理解这一点:某用户由于误删除或丢失存储私钥的设备,无法找回,结果导致其账户内的比特币永远处于“锁定”状态,无法使用。
因此,用户应定期备份关键数据,并使用安全的状态保存那些备份。
安全生成私钥的方式包括使用专业生成软件或硬件加密设备。在生成好私钥后,可以手动记录并放入安全的地点,避免使用电脑或互联网记录。在保存私钥时,最好采用冷存储方式,比如刻在金属板或保存在防火防水的保险箱中。
除了物理存储外,用户还应定期检查备份是否完好,以防盗取和损坏。
在比特币及其他数字货币中,每个比特币地址都对应唯一的私钥。这意味着虽然一个钱包可以有多个地址和多个私钥,用户必须确保每个私钥的安全和隐私。同样,多个钱包和私钥不能随意混用,因为这会导致混淆和资产丢失的风险。
此外,生成新的地址与旧地址混淆可能导致错误引用和意外的交易结果,因此用户在操作时请保持明确。
当发起一笔交易时,用户钱包中的私钥会被用来签署交易,这一过程证明了用户对所发比特币的所有权。钱包软件会从用户的比特币数量中扣除相应的比特币,并生成新交易的哈希值,同时利用私钥生成一个数字签名。
这个签名会被附加到交易中,发送至比特币网络以便其他节点验证。交易一旦被确认,私钥不会再泄露,因此用户在交易时要确保交易的准确性,避免误发比特币。
HD钱包(分层确定性钱包)是新一代钱包,其最大不同是通过生成一个主私钥,并基于主私钥生成无限数量的子私钥。这意味着HD钱包能够确保用户在不同地址之间的交易隐私,同时也简化了管理过程。用户只需记住主私钥,而无需为每个新地址处理单独的私钥。
与此相比,普通钱包每个地址都需单独生成和管理,对私钥的组织和存储变得复杂。而HD钱包大幅度简化了这一问题,更加适合大多数用户,特别是常进行交易的人。
一个比特币钱包可以有多个私钥,这与用户的需求和钱包的类型息息相关。无论选择哪种钱包,用户务必确保私钥的安全管理,以防止资产的损失。通过本文的介绍,希望读者对比特币钱包及其私钥的管理有了更深入的理解。